Mama Shelter appoints executive head chef and F&B director

Mama Shelter hotel in London's Shoreditch has appointed James Green as executive head chef and Mattia Rinaldi as F&B director to create a compelling offering for the hotel's restaurant and Garden Bar.

Green has spent more than 20 years working in establishments such as Drake & Morgan, Gordon Ramsay Group and Mango Tree. He will develop a new global menu concept for the Accor hotel with dishes including fish & chips, California rainbow salad and a peri peri chicken burger.

Green said: "I'm very excited to join the Mama Shelter brand. Mama Shelter London Shoreditch is well situated, inviting in a community that is obsessed with good and creative food. The concept menu is reflective of the vibrant and diverse community, whilst also educating our visitors that Mama is a global brand and inviting them to experience a taste of standout locations across the world."

Rinaldi has held roles at Gaucho Restaurants and the Ivy Collection. He said: "Joining the Mama Group will be such an exciting challenge. I'm thrilled to be part of an incredible global brand, and representing a strong team in its only UK property. East London has such a great audience, and I can't wait to entice them in with the new F&B offering."

Mama Shelter general manger, Robert Alam added: "At Mama Shoreditch, we're placing a key focus on our food and beverage offering to further enhance and appeal to the local community and provide delicious options to our guests. Mattia and James both bring a wealth of creative experience, and we look forward to seeing the impact the new menus bring."
